Building Your First AI Tool Server: Creating a Pokédex with FastMCP and Python
Do you want your AI applications to do more than answer questions? The Model Context Protocol (MCP) is becoming the standard for connecting language models with tools, APIs, and external systems. In this workshop you will learn to build your first MCP server using FastMCP and Python. Through a completely hands-on experience, we will explore the fundamental concepts of the protocol, how to expose tools, and how to integrate them with compatible clients such as Claude. As the main project, we will build an interactive Pokédex connected to the PokéAPI. Participants will develop real tools to query Pokémon information, expose them through an MCP server, and allow a language model to use them autonomously. Upon completion, you will have developed your own FastMCP server, understand the fundamentals of MCP, and have a solid foundation for creating AI-native applications connected to real data and services.
